Sri Basavaraj College of Nursing, established in 2003/2004, is a private nursing institution located in Chitradurga District, Karnataka. Affiliated with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ences (RGUHS) and approved by the Indian Nursing Council (INC) and Karnataka Nursing Council (KNC), the college offers undergraduate and diploma programs in nursing. The flagship B.Sc. Nursing program admits 40–60 students annually and spans 4 years. Sri Basavaraj College of Nursing Courses & Fees
Sri Basavaraj College of Nursing offers undergraduate and diploma programs in nursing, including B.Sc. Nursing and General Nursing and Midwifery (GNM). The B.Sc. Nursing program has a duration of 4 years with an intake of 40–60 students and requires candidates to have completed 10+2 with 45% in Physics, Chemistry, Biology. The GNM program is a 3-year diploma course for students with 10+2 (40%) eligibility. The total fee for B.Sc. Nursing is approximately INR 2,00,000.
Program | Level | Duration | Eligibility | Total Fees |
B.Sc. Nursing | Undergraduate | 4 years | 10+2 (45% PCB), KCET | INR 2,00,000 |
GNM (General Nursing & Midwifery) | Diploma | 3 years | 10+2 (40%) | NA |
Sri Basavaraj College of Nursing Admission Process
Admissions to the B.Sc. Nursing program are based on 10+2 (Science stream) marks and, for some seats, KCET entrance exam scores. The application process typically opens in April–May each year. Selection is primarily merit-based, with no group discussion or personal interview stages reported. Required documents include academic transcripts, proof of age, and eligibility certificates.
Application Window: April–May 2025
Entrance Exams (if any): KCET (for B.Sc. Nursing)
Selection Stages (GD/PI/WAT/etc.): Merit-based; generally no GD/PI
Step | Details | Indicative Timeline | Documents |
Application Submission | Online/Offline form with required details | April–May 2025 | 10+2 Marksheet, ID Proof, Passport Photo |
Entrance Exam (if applicable) | KCET for eligible candidates | May 2025 | KCET Admit Card |
Merit List & Counseling | Selection based on marks/score | June 2025 | All original certificates |
Admission Confirmation | Fee payment & document verification | June–July 2025 | Fee Receipt, Eligibility Certificate |
